I did find a slight bug in my functions list builder, but that has since been fixed.. the SIOCONS part of the code is working great. You can have the program launch the dos version, or you can use the built in WIN95/NT version of the transfer protocols.. This is separate from the IDE program: I do want to get one more thing working.. Hopfully I can finish it up over the next week or so.. I was in the middle of coding a com server for the Yaroze. It would allow you to transfer files between the Yaroze and the PC while your Yaroze is running. That way we could use the PC as if it were a CD-ROM. My buddy will code a UNIX end for the Com server. I figure MAC people will not need one since they pretty much have one with MW Codewarrior. Future things that would be cool: I was talking to a friend of mine and we had a brief chat about FMV.. He thought he might be able to tranform QuickTimes into a format for the Yaroze so we could stream QT's via my com server using a ring buffer... Dunno about this yet.. Purely theory...
